With kernels up to 2.6.15, the kernel does print the various AE_TIME error
messages on suspend/resume (like the ones you highlighted), but apart from those
ACPI appears to work flawlessly. If I dig deep enough I might find minor things
not working (no battery events? can't remember), but nothing serious. And no
beeps. :^)

The laptop does have the latest BIOS and Embedded Controller Program, though
keep in mind that this is an old laptop, so these are dated 2003-05-29 and
2002-10-25 respectively (from what I can see at the IBM/Lenovo website). I can
confirm all these later today when I'll have access to it, and also post
/proc/interrupts, which is fairly boring mind you: ACPI and the first PCI device
to be probed get IRQ 9 (e100 for 2.6.15-suspend2 and 2.6.16-rc6 with ec_intr=0,
uhci_hcd for 2.6.16-rc6 with ec_intr=1), the other PCI devices get IRQ 11, and
the rest is at the usual places.
